Source connection from PBI Service

Hello community,

I've a pretty specific case. I'd like to create a data refresh for my customer. Therefore, we've set up a gateway and everything works fine within the service. Now, I need to change the data connection in my local report file via PBI Desktop. But from my development computer, I haven't access to my clients on-premise data source, but the PBI service has!

 

I changed the connection settings in Power Query in the advanced editor. I saved the file and clicked on "apply changes later". Than I've uploaded my report and tried to configure the data source refresh settings. But it still has the old connection information...

 

Do you have any solution for my very issue? How can I solve this without connection to customers on-premise systems?
